## Firmware Update Channel — Contacts

Plugin authors targeting the Lanternwood device-firmware update channel should note that channel promotion (beta to stable) is handled by the firmware release team, not plugin reviewers. Compatibility questions, signing issues, and rollout scheduling all go through them. Response time is typically two business days. Direct all channel-related inquiries to the address below.

escalation mailbox, bafog-fafog: ulador@paliqlabs.internal

## Deployment

Deploying TumbleKey (our laundry-locker access flow) is a one-command affair: run the release script and it pushes the gateway plus the locker-firmware shim together — don't ship them separately, the handshake versions must match. Reviewers: please sanity-check that nothing here touches the PIN retry limits without a flag. The values the deploy script bakes in are as follows.

settings of yafog-kagep:
NOVVAN_PIN=8841
NOVVAN_TENANT=pelwyn
NOVVAN_METRICS_HOST=metrics.novvan.orvexforge.example
NOVVAN_SEAL=seal_30060f3e
NOVVAN_STANDBY_TEAM=wenox

## 4.2.0 — Hermetic build defaults

As part of migrating Lanternforge to the Cinderbox hermetic build system, several long-standing defaults changed. Network access during builds is now denied, toolchains are pinned rather than resolved from the host, and output paths are content-addressed. Local caches carried over from the old system are ignored. After the migration, the build daemon starts with the following default configuration values.

config for bawig-fadup:
[zorix]
host = zorix.lumicworks.corp
user = zorix_svc
database = zorix_prod

Subject: Wiki RBAC cut-over complete. Hi — summarizing the Fernvale wiki cut-over finished last night. All legacy group permissions were migrated to the new role model; editors and reviewers map one-to-one, and the old admin catch-all was split into space-admin and global-admin. Orphaned accounts were set to read-only pending review. No permission escalations were detected in the diff audit. For your review, the final role-mapping configuration is below:

config for bahop-fajep:
DRUATH_PIN=4501
DRUATH_TENANT=briwyn
DRUATH_METRICS_HOST=metrics.druath.brasksoft.test
DRUATH_SEAL=seal_7d2e069d
DRUATH_STANDBY_TEAM=olieth